MANY AIR ATTACKS
ON JAPANESE IN SOLOMONS. SOME COUNTER-EFFORTS BY ENEMY. (British Official Wireless.) (Received This Day, 12.5 p.m.) RUGBY, January 24. An American Navy Department communique states: “American planes attacked Japanese installations in the Solomons area seven times within 48 hours, while enemy flyers attacked our bases there twice.”
